Crews to build a ‘bubble' by Bertha

SEATTLE — After digging three exploratory shafts, WSDOT didn't find anything significant jamming the front of the machine boring the SR 99 waterfront tunnel.

The agency and its contractor, Seattle Tunnel Partners, now plan to build a hyperbaric “bubble” within Bertha's excavation chamber so that workers can inspect the machine more closely.
